My Bottom Freezer refrigerator stopped cooling a few weeks ago. I checked the compressor compartment and the fan is still running. The compressor relay and capacitor tested OK (resistance btwn 5-10). The compressor also checks out OK. I tested the defrost timer (turning clockwise) and that does not seem to be the problem either. I then opened up the freezer compartment and tested the temperature control thermostat. I tested resistance while it was OFF…and no reading as expected. The tested it ON and it made sound, indicating a connection…so this was also tested OK. The final test I did was to test the Defrost Thermostat. I disconnected it and placed it into a cup of ice cold water for a few minutes and tested the resistance again (Ohms). The ohmmeter should sound (resistance) when I tested it in the cold water, but no sound, and no reading, indicating an issue. I did the test numerous times and same result. Lastly, today, while the defrost thermostat was unplugged and I had the refrigerator open (ice tray disconnected, defrost thermostat disconnected), I plugged the refrigerator into the outlet and the compressor came on and it started to freeze again. My question is this, could a bad defrost timer prevent the compressor from starting, even though my freezer didn’t have a froze over problem? I searched all over the web and all advice pointed to a bad relay or temperature control thermostat. But both (all) of these tested OK. I ordered a defrost timer because I concluded it was bad anyway. I unplugged the refrigerator again and left it off. Again, what else am I missing here?

About 1.5 weeks ago our freezer section started warming up, to the point where some things were frozen and others weren’t. We cleaned things up from the vents and adjusted the settings but it got worse, to the point where it wasn’t close to freezing a couple days ago, which is when I got serious about finding what was happening.

I took the back off and found the compressor fan had an obstruction which I removed (poor mouse, I have no idea how he got in the house as we’ve never seen any before), it span right up and I figured everything would be fine after that. Things were quite warm/hot near the fan but cooled off quickly after the fan was working. The fan spins fast and has great airflow, there wasn’t much dust so I cleaned up it, put the cover back on, and left it running overnight.

The next day the freezer was barely cooler than room temperature. I removed the back panel in the freezer and found a big chunk of ice around the top/beginning of the evaporator unit (big meaning perhaps 3 inches in diameter in an oval shape), a little frost on the pipe leading to the radiator but only a little at the beginning of the radiator. I turned it off for a couple hours to let it all melt away.

After it had melted I turned it back on, a couple hours later the beginning of the radiator has a tiny bit of frost but very little actual cooling happening.

A friend who has more experience than I (and a clamp-on ammeter) checked the compressor and we can hear the relay click on and it will stay on using about 10 amps for about 10 seconds and then click off for a few minutes, repeat. Otherwise the compressor fan and evaporator fans are working fine, we just have no cooling. My friends thought is it is the compressor, perhaps locked up from getting too hot.

Any other things to try or is it time to get a new fridge? Thanks for any advice.
